    My Ravelry Project Page Pattern : Newborn Vertebrae by Kelly van Niekirk (only on Ravelry) Needle : US 2 - 2.75mm                  US 3 - 3.25mm Yarn :  Filcolana Arwetta Classic in color 811 Started : September 23, 2020 Completed : September 29, 2020 Notes : Making this for my cousin's first child due in November     9/28/2020 : Finished the body and first sleeve. I do not like how the sleeve pick up went. I was surprised that the instructions did not state to cast on a couple stitches after placing the sleeve stitches on hold. The pick up to close the hole under the arm still leaves a hole no matter where I pick up the extra stitch to join in the round. I will probably need to go in and weave it together after I'm done.

  My Ravelry Project Page Pattern : Eight Bit by Lattes & Llamas (only on Ravelry) Needle : US 2.5 - 3.00mm                  US 4 - 3.50mm Yarn :  Lion Brand Mandala in Spirit              Yarn Bee Soft & Sleek DK in Black Started : September 10, 2020 Completed : Notes : This will be my first all over colorwork garment 9/20/20: Knitting Diary | 8-bit & Vegas Vlog 10/5/20: Still on Clue 1, but I'm loving the look so far. I got confused with the directions for chart A but didn't notice I worked it wrong until I was done with the first 15 rows.....Needless to say I had to rip it back and redo it. Apparently I'm the only one that didn't understand the instruction! When the instruction said work chart A around, I took that to mean work the chart the entire way around the sleeve and that was not right.
